Understanding BDM Meaning: Duties, Responsibilities, and Career Trajectory
The abbreviation "BDM" frequently surfaces in the corporate world, but what does it actually imply? Broadly, BDM stands for Business Development Executive, a crucial role within a company focused on fostering growth. Their essential responsibilities generally encompass identifying new areas, building relationships with potential partners, and executing strategies to increase profits. A BDM might be tasked with analyzing industry shifts, finalizing deals, and representing the company's products. The professional path for a BDM often begins with a background in sales, followed by expertise in business development. Advancement may lead to Senior Business Development roles, or potentially towards management roles get more info within the broader company.

Understanding BDM vs. BDMG: Key Variations Explained
While both Business Development Managers (BDMs) and Business Development Management Groups (BDM Units) play vital roles in driving growth, their scope and structure differ significantly. A Business Development Manager is typically an individual responsible for generating new business prospects and nurturing client partnerships – they are a proactive force within a company. Conversely, a BDMG represents a larger team or division dedicated to managing and overseeing the entire business growth process. Think of the BDM as the front-line scout, while the BDMG delivers the overall map and resources for multiple Business Development Executives. Therefore, one is a role, and the other is a structure.
